Страница:
67 из 71
А из программирования уже, обычно, так просто не возвращаются…
Лекция 13. СЛОЖНОСТЬ ВЫЧИСЛЕНИЙ
Мало того, что есть алгоритмически неразрешимые задачи и их бесконечно больше, чем задач алгоритмически разрешимых. С практической точки зрения нам не легче, если решение разрешимой задачи мы сможем получим через миллион лет. Раньше не закончить расчеты… Это трудно-решаемые задачи. Для нас (простых смертных) такие задачи не отличаются от задач алгоритмически неразрешимых.
А ситуация с такими задачами еще более туманная, чем с алгоритмической разрешимостью. Пока единственный, фактически, «железный» аргумент нашей беспомощности, что задача относится к трудно-решаемым, что никто пока не нашел для нее легкого решения! Даже американские политики.
Ненормальность такой ситуации усугубится, если учесть, что теоретики рассматривают только конечные дискретные задачи (задачи либо на поиск оптимума, либо распознавания [да-нет]), любая из которых (теоретически) может быть решена хотя бы (за неимением лучшего) простым перебором. Но от этого не легче, если вспомнить легенду об изобретателе шахмат, который попросил в награду за первую клеточку шахматной доски одно зернышко, за вторую два… за 64-ю клеточку – 2 в 64-ой степени зернышек. Что превышает зерновые ресурсы Земного шара.
Одна из книг по сложности вычислений начиналась с цитаты из украинского философа Георгия Сковороды:" Спасибо тебе Господи, что ты создал все нужное нетрудным, а все трудное – ненужным.
|< Пред. 65 66 67 68 69 След. >|